Looks like Dungeon Stone was right, they have invested too heavily in the most recent waves and can't get rid of them.   :nono:


That's the problem that smaller companies like Toynami have to potentially deal with.

It does seem odd that they wouldn't have protected themselves though by having a termination clause in their contract with the retailer that detailed out a payment to cover production costs in the event of the order being dropped.

The only thing that I can figure is that it was either a bad call by Toynami's lawyers or the retailer in question could have gone into some degree of bankruptcy protection.

Another problem is when manufacturers start liquidating their unsold stock to clear it out, it makes purchasing agents for retailers become wary of ordering a new wave of toys from the same line.

Their reasoning is.. "If the last wave sold so badly that Toynami has to almost give it away, then interest in the toyline is probably dying off and I had better steer clear of this new wave".
